Ronan man admits to felony sexual assault

A Ronan man, accused of sexually assaulting four minors, admitted to one of the related charges.
Glenn Alan Jorgenson, 68, entered a plea of guilty in District Court in Polson Nov. 19 to one count of felony sexual assault. The plea was entered as part of an agreement that could dismiss three other counts.
It comes with a joint recommendation of 10 years with the Montana Department of Corrections, with all that time suspended. The judge is not bound by the agreement.
According to court records, the incident that led to the charges occurred in Ronan between June 18 and July 18, 2024. At the time, the four alleged victims ranged in age from 9-years to 13-years old.
Judge Molly Owen set the case for sentencing on Jan. 7. Jorgenson is at liberty.
